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
Job Title: Software Engineer IV
Location: Redmond, WA (On-site)
Duration: 12 Months to start
The ideal candidate is a highly creative individual who has expertise in 3D interactive experiences and proficiency in Unity. Join the adventure of a lifetime as we make science fiction real and change the world. You’ll be responsible for designing and developing infrastructure and interactions within Unity. Your work will entail supporting ongoing projects, building new infra, and ensuring parity of useful Unreal and Unity infrastructure. You’ll work closely with designers, engineers, and researchers.
Top 3 Must-Have Skills
- 8-10 years of experience with 3-5+ years of prototyping or game development related experience
- 4+ years development experience in Python, C#, or C++
- 3+ years of experience with Unreal (infrastructure/tools/plugins)
- Knowledge in game development, tools, and pipelines including working with 3D assets, scripting/tool development, shaders (GLSL/HSLG), VFX, post processing, and/or procedural effects and animations
- Portfolio featuring examples of tools, graphic rendering workflows, interactive prototype work, etc.
Responsibilities:
- Build software tools, infrastructure, documentation and other systems that will be used by the designers, researchers, and engineers to improve and assist their work.
- Train deep learning models for use in interaction explorations and design
- Work with researchers to design, test and iterate on prototypes and user studies
- Integrate, validate and optimize data in pipelines by using scripts if needed
- Produce and maintain documentation on tools, methods, training, processes for consultation and future reference
- Develop and maintain tools surrounding integrated machine learning infrastructure
- Design and develop core tools (UI, I/O modules) into the pipeline.
- Work closely with design, research and other development team members to further develop pipeline and workflows.
Minimum Qualifications:
- BS in Computer Science, OR equivalent game development/engine experience
- 3-5+ years of prototyping or game development related experience
- 4+ years development experience in Python, C#, or C++
- 3+ years of experience with Unreal (infrastructure/tools/plugins)
- Knowledge in game development, tools, and pipelines including working with 3D assets, scripting/tool development, shaders (GLSL/HSLG), VFX, post processing, and/or procedural effects and animations
- Portfolio featuring examples of tools, graphic rendering workflows, interactive prototype work, etc.
Preferred Qualifications:
- Knowledge of UI development for Tools (React, QT)
- Experience working with source control (Git, Perforce, Mercurial)
- 3D authoring software (3DS Max, Maya, Blender, Cinema 4D)
- Experience with AR/VR development
- Proficiency with game engine development
- Experience working with designers and research scientists
- Full stack backend experience, including server-side infrastructure and database management
- 3D art/design experience (e.g., character/motion rigging and animation)
Degrees: BS in Computer Science, OR equivalent game development/engine experience
Key Skills
Ranked by relevanceReady to apply?
Join Intelliswift - An LTTS Company and take your career to the next level!
Application takes less than 5 minutes